Přeskočit přímo na text


Jak zamknout skupinu polí?

Kategorie: Jak na to?
Týká se verze: Drupal 7.x

V registračním formuláři pro vytvoření uživatelského účtu mám dvě skupiny polí, které se zobrazí podle toho jaký typ registrace si dotyčný zvolí. Chtěl bych dosáhnout toho, aby při následné editaci svého účtu viděl pouze pole vztahující se k jeho volbě (typu registrace). Věděl by někdo jak na to? Díky.

 

mozna by to slo tak, ze by se

mozna by to slo tak, ze by se pres rules pri registraci priradila jedna nebo druha role a pak pouzit field permissions.

A když použijete modul

A když použijete modul Conditional fields, tak to nestačí? Vidí přece jen pole v závislosti na již zaškrtnutých polích??? nebo ne?

Zaškrtnuté pole

V registračním formuláři je to OK, potíž je pak následně při editaci účtu – tam uživatel vidí obě volby. Chtěl bych dosáhnout toho, aby při následné editaci svého účtu viděl pouze pole vztahující se k jeho volbě (typu registrace).

aha, nevěděla jsem, že pak

aha, nevěděla jsem, že pak nesmí tu volbu už změnit. Potom asi opravdu Field permissions a přiřazení role pomocí Rules, jak psal kolega výše.

Field permissions

Ano, vyzkouším, díky :-)

hook_form_alter

A čo tak urobiť hook_form_alter na formulár v editácii?

Poslat nový komentář

Obsah tohoto pole je soukromý a nebude veřejně zobrazen.
  • You can use Texy! to format and alter entered content.
  • Povolené HTML značky: <a> <em> <strong> <cite> <code> <ul> <ol> <li> <p> <br> <b> <i> <h2> <img> <pre> <sup> <sub> <pre class="php"> <span class="php-keyword1"> <span class="php-var"> <span class="php-num"> <img class="screenshot"> <p class="beginner"> <a class="greybox"> <h3> <h4>

Více informací o možnostech formátování

Type the characters you see in this picture. (verify using audio)
Type the characters you see in the picture above; if you can't read them, submit the form and a new image will be generated. Not case sensitive.

Hledat

Přihlášení

Bezpečnost Drupalu

Z hlediska bezpečnosti je Drupal na velmi vysoké úrovni, díky propracovanému systému hlášení, prověřování a řešení možných problémů.

Čtěte více a odebírejte bezpečnostní aktuality

Poslední komentáře

Kdo je online

Momentálně je online 1 uživatel a 0 hostů.

Online uživatelé